Frequently Asked Questions about Calvert
What type of rentals are currently available in Calvert?
There are currently 46 Apartments for Rent in Calvert, TX with pricing that ranges from $559 to $3,738. There are also 39 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Calvert ranging from $650 to $4,695.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Calvert?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Calvert ranges from $650 to $4,695 with an average monthly rent of $1,908.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Calvert?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Calvert range from $583 to $2,320,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$875 to $2,850.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,850 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$559.
